
SOPRANOS, THE: A HIT IS A HIT (TV)
Summary
One in this darkly comic, dramatic series centering around the crime empire and family life of Tony Soprano, a modern-day Mafia boss. In this episode, Tony's neighbor invites him play golf at the private club, and Christopher takes Adriana to Broadway after financial matters work out to the family's benefit. In the crowd, Adriana recognizes gangster rapper and entertainment businessman Massive Genius. Genius says he needs to discuss some "business" with Hesh, and Christopher agrees to act as go-between. Meanwhile, Carmela begins to worry about finances should anything ever happen to Tony. Hesh and Genius meet about past residuals that Hesh may have stolen from a musical artist related to Genius. And Adriana is hoping to launch a band's career using Christopher's connection to Genius. In the meantime, Dr. Melfi feels uncomfortable at a dinner party when her colleagues discuss Tony. During a therapy session, Tony explains that Carmela feels they should meet new people. As she and Tony attend a neighbor's barbecue, Carmela learns some tips on playing the stock market. While the recording sessions with Adriana's band go well, Christopher loses his temper in the studio. And as Tony goes to play golf with his neighbor and his friends, he feels uncomfortable when they ask him questions about the Mafia's history. Hesh informs Genius about his decision regarding the royalties and, displeased, Genius counters with a lawsuit. And Christopher tells Adriana that the only reason she received the record deal was because Genius was interested in her. As the program concludes, Tony plays a practical joke on his neighbor.
